14 minutes ago, Flandre said:

Sit-ups are bad for your spine

Very true if done incorrectly. Not lifting the back off the ground here and going slowly.

The same actually goes for push-ups which are not the best for your shoulders' rotator cuffs and elbows when done too fast or too wide. You can do almost every exerise wrong and cause more damage than benefits.

Note since you guys both already do sit-ups, that planks can be made harder in various ways (maybe google "make planks harder") if you're able to do them for a full minute without too much struggle.


For front planks, the simplest thing is to put your feet up on a stool or just slightly elevated in any way, and for side planks you could do side bridges (which Lumi did on day one and that's why our sides hurt so much the next day lol)
